発達

hattatsu [ha̠t̚ta̠t͡sɯᵝ]

Development or growth in terms of physical size, mental capability, or complex systems like technology and civilization. It describes the process of moving from a simple or early stage to a more advanced and mature state.

例句

1

子供の体が発達するのは早いです。

everyday

Children's bodies develop quickly.

2

この地域は交通網が高度に発達しています。

formal

The transportation network in this region is highly developed.

3

あの人、筋肉がすごく発達してるね!

informal

That person's muscles are really well-developed, aren't they!

4

言語の発達に関する新しい研究が発表された。

academic

A new study regarding language development was published.

5

インターネットの発達により、ビジネスの形が変わりました。

business

The development of the internet has changed the way business is done.

常见搭配

技術の発達 development of technology
筋肉の発達 muscle development
文明の発達 development of civilization
子供の心の発達 development of a child's mind
低気圧が発達する a low-pressure system intensifies

常用短语

発達段階

developmental stage

精神発達

mental development

発達障害

developmental disorder

容易混淆的词

発達 vs 発展

Hatten focuses on the expansion of scope or scale (like a business growing), while Hattatsu focuses on the internal maturation or advancement of a system/body.

発達 vs 成長

Seichou is mostly used for living things growing bigger/older, whereas Hattatsu includes technology, systems, and specific functional skills.

📝

使用说明

Use this word when talking about things becoming more complex or advanced, such as technology, or when describing the biological/mental growth of a human.

⚠️

常见错误

Learners often use 'hatten' when they mean 'hattatsu' regarding biological growth. You cannot say a child's height 'hatten' (expanded); you use 'seichou' or 'hattatsu'.

💡

记忆技巧

Hatsu (start/departure) + Tatsu (reach/attain). Think of something starting its journey and reaching its full potential.

📖

词源

A Sino-Japanese word combining 'hatsu' (to emit/occur) and 'tatsu' (to reach/attain).

语法模式

Noun + が + 発達する (intransitive) 発達した + Noun (past participle as adjective)
🌍

文化背景

Often used in Japanese education and healthcare when discussing a child's milestones (Hattatsu-kensa).
